Critical Home Repair

Critical home repair is a service that addresses urgent health and safety repairs for low-to moderate-income homeowners.

Common repairs include:

  • Roofing and structural stabilization
  • Plumbing, electrical and HVAC upgrades
  • Accessibility improvements such as ramps and grab bars

The service is offered by local nonprofits such as Habitat for Humanity Charlotte Region, Rebuilding Together Greater Charlotte, Greater Matthews Habitat for Humanity and She Built this City.

Eligibility Criteria

  • Must own and occupy the home
  • Income at or below 80% of the Area Median Income
  • Property taxes are current
  • Have or willing to obtain homeowners insurance
  • Funded as a forgivable loan - no repayment if homeowner stays in the home for at least 5 years after the repair(s)
